Frog lysozyme. I. Its identification, occurrence as isozymes, and quantitative distribution in tissues of the leopard frog, Rana pipiens. In the course of examining the etiology of the Lucké renal adenocarcinoma of the frog, Rana pipiens, it was found that organs of the normal adult contain bacteriolytic enzymes.

Kinetic and pharmacological properties of the sodium channel of frog skeletal muscle. Na channels of frog skeletal muscle are studied under voltage clamp and their properties compared with those of frog myelinated nerve. A standard mathematical model is fitted to the sodium currents measured in nerve and in muscle to obtain a quantitative description of the gating kinetics.

Cation transport in Escherichia coli. VIII. Potassium transport mutants. Analysis of K transport mutants indicates the existence of four separate K uptake systems in Escherichia coli K-12. A high affinity system called Kdp has a Km of 2 muM, and Vmax at 37 degrees C of 150 mumol/g min.

Some properties of the pyruvate carboxylase from Pseudomonas fluorescens. The pyruvate carboxylase of Pseudonomas fluorescens was purified 160-fold from cells grown on glucose at 20 degrees C. The activity of this purified enzyme was not affected by acetyl-coenzyme A or L-aspartate, but was strongly inhibited by ADP, which was competitive towards ATP.

Cyanide intoxication in the rat: physiological and neuropathological aspects. Sodium cyanide was given to rats by intravenous infusion at a rate that would avert apnoea (the first sign of overdosage) in the majority. There was full physiological monitoring in a group under anaesthesia and more limited monitoring in an unanaesthetized group. White matter was damaged in six animals and grey matter additionally in only one. It was concluded that cyanide can damage neurones only through the medium of secondary effects on circulation and respiration.

Stability of some pyridoxal phosphate-dependent enzymes in vitamin B-6 deficient rats. The effects of lowering the liver pyridoxal phosphate (PLP) concentration by vitamin B-6 deficiency on the stability of several rat liver enzymes were examined. Three PLP-dependent enzymes (serine dehydratase, ornithine-delta-aminotransferase, and tyrosine aminotransferase) and two non-PLP-dependent enzymes (glucose-6-phosphate dehydrogenase and phosphoenolpyruvate carboxykinase) were induced in vitamin B-6 deficient and control rats by feeding them high-protein diets or by injecting them with glucagon or dexamethasone.

Adsorption sites of kaolin. The electrophoretic mobility and adsorptive properties of kaolin and kaolin pretreated with anionic and cationic materials were examined over a range of pH values. Pretreatment with anionic compounds had little effect on mobility, while adsorption of cationic species markedly reduced mobility. These results are explained by reference to the structure of kaolin, and the interdependence of adsorption properties and electrophoretic mobility are discussed.

Electrode sensitive to sulfa drugs. An electrode sensitive to sulfa drugs was constructed by using the iron(II)-bathophenanthroline chelate embedded in a liquid membrane. Rapid and Nernstian responses were exhibited against solutions of sulfamerazine and sulfisomidine ranging between 10(-3) and 10(-1) M in concentration. High selectivity was observed in the presence of urea, glycine, aminopyrine, or p-amino-benzoic acid. These chemicals are known to interfere in the usual colorimetric analysis of sulfa drugs.

Mass fragmentography of morphine: relationship between brain levels and analgesic activity. Morphine levels in rat brain were measured by the multiple ion detection method (mass fragmentography), using a computer-controlled gas chromatograph-mass spectrometer, and were correlated with the analgesic activity of the narcotic at intervals up to 6 hours after the injection.

Vasoconstrictor actions of delta8- and delta9-tetrahydrocannabinol in the rat. Cardiovascular effects of delta8- and delta9-tetrahydrocannabinol (THC) were studied after systemic intravenous administration and intra-arterial administration into a perfused vascular bed in the urethane-anesthetized rat. Intravenous administration of delta8- and delta9-THC produced dose-related transient increases in blood pressure followed by more prolonged hypotensive responses and bradycardia.

A pharmacological analysis of neurally induced inhibition of carotid body chemoreceptor activity in cats. Experiments were performed to determine the mechanism by which centrifugal impulses in the carotid sinus nerve (CSN) reduce the frequency of impulse traffic in afferent chemoreceptor fibers from the carotid body in cats. Recordings of chemoreceptor activity were made from single- or few-fiber preparations dissected off the CSN, while the remainder of the CSN was stimulated electrically to produce neurally induced inhibition of chemoreceptor activity.

On the ability of narcotic antagonists to produce the narcotic cue. The ability of narcotic antagonists to produce the narcotic cue was investigated in rats trained to discriminate fentanyl (0.04 mg/kg) from solvent. The partial antagonists pentazocine, cyclazocine and nalorphine were found to possess narcotic cuing activity whereas naloxone lacked any such action at doses up to 160 mg/kg.

Regulation of cell volume and ion concentrations in a Halobacterium. Changes in cell volume and ion content of a Halobacterium species are described in terms of the NaCl concentration (0.5--3.5M) and pH(4-8) of the suspending medium. Cell volume, per unit content of protein of bacteria in stationary phase cultures, rose as the [NaCl] of the growth medium was increased.

Behavioral and psychodynamic dimensions of the new sex therapy. The new sexual therapy, a brief outpatient treatment of sexual dysfunction consisting of structured sexual exercises and conjoint therapeutic sessions, is a systematic intergration of behavioral and psychodynamic elements. Formally consisting of many defining characteristics of a behavior therapy including the direct treatment of a specified problem and the application of behavioral principles, the new sex therapy also relies on psychodynamic understanding.

Two rare cases of ectopic testis. A case of pubopenile testis and a case of perineal ectopic testis are presented. The mechanism of descensus is largely positive, possibly facilitated by raised intra-abdominal pressure. The testis is usually guided by the gubernaculum and ectopia results from gubernacular failure. The ectopic testis is relatively rare but is easily recognized and treated by orchiopexy.

pH of sweat of patients with cystic fibrosis. pH of the sweat from patients with cystic fibrosis and in controls was measured as a function of the sweat-rate using a fluorescence-pH-indicator (umbelliferone). In both populations sweat is acid at low sweat-rates and alkaline at high ones. The results do not favour an abnormality of the ductal H+-secretion as the pathomechanism of cystic fibrosis.

[Conditioning of water regenerated from moisture-containing wastes]. Conditioning of reclaimed water with minerals and trace elements by means of filters made of silver-plated natural minerals containing calcium, magnesium, fluoride and iodine ions has been investigated. On the basis of the investigations a complex filter made of silver plated minerals--dolomite and fluorite--has been developed. This filter allows simultaneous mineralization and decontamination of reclaimed water and preparation of biologically complete potable water.

Proteins of the hepatoma tissue culture cell plasma membrane. The specificity of lactoperoxidase-catalyzed iodination for the proteins of the hepatoma tissue culture cell plasma membrane was examined by histochemical, biochemical, and cell fractionation techniques. Light microscope autoradiography of sectioned cells shows the incorporated label to be localized primarily at the periphery of the cell.
